A senior Taliban leader on Friday responded to Prince Harry's claim that he viewed the 25 Taliban soldiers he killed in Afghanistan as"chess pieces" instead of people.
“It was not something that filled me with satisfaction, but I was not ashamed either,” the prince wrote, according to Sky News, which obtained a copy of the book.Taliban leader Anas Haqqani heatedly responded to the passage, slamming the British prince for not viewing the rebels as people with families.
1/3- Mr. Harry! The ones you killed were not chess pieces, they were humans; they had families who were waiting for their return. Among the killers of Afghans, not many have your decency to reveal their conscience and confess to their war crimes. pic.twitter.com/zjDwoDmCN1The Taliban returned to power in Afghanistan after the United States withdrew its forces in 2021.
"The other problem I found with his comments was that he characterized the British Army basically as having trained him and other soldiers to see his enemy as less than human, just as chess pieces on a board to be swiped off, which is not the case. It's the opposite of the case," Kemp told Sky News.
